How can I add SAP system in Web IDE Personal Edition?
Procedure
- Go to SAP Development tools.
- Select the SAPUI5 tab and scroll down to SAP BTP Web IDE personal edition.
- Download the installation ZIP file.
- Extract the zipped files. Note.
- Start SAP Web IDE personal edition. For more information, see Start SAP Web IDE Personal Edition.
How do I open local WebIDE?
Using the Google Chrome browser, launch this URL to start the WebIDE: http://localhost:8080/webide/index.html. Create a new account, and you are ready to use the SAP WebIDE personal edition.

How do I run WebIDE?
SAP Web IDE comes with integrated testing features that let you run the app on a central server without having to set up any additional infrastructure. You can run the app by selecting the src/index. html file and clicking the run button in the header toolbar.
How do I add a destination in SAP Web IDE?
Configuring the Destinations for Your SAP Web IDE Account
- In SAP Web IDE, from the Tools menu, choose SAP Cloud Platform Cockpit.
- Choose Connectivity Destinations.
- Choose New Destination.
- Choose New Property under Additional Properties and add the following property:
- Save the destination.
- Choose Check Connection.

Is SAP web IDE obsolete?
On November 13, 2020 the SAP Cloud Platform, Neo trial environment will be discontinued and as a result SAP Web IDE Full-Stack trial will also be discontinued. If you have an existing Neo trial account, you can continue using it including SAP Web IDE Full-Stack until November 13, 2020.
